DNA Physical Properties
  • Rigid (because of hydrogen bonding between
    bases, particularly G C
  • Very long molecule
  • Heating separates strands by breaking hydrogen
    bonds between bases-called Denaturation.
  • On cooling bonds are re-formed- Annealing.
  • Denaturation causes a decrease in solution
    viscosity.

8
DNA Properties contd
  • DNA precipitates in alcohol.
  • Long strands of DNA can be spooled on glass
    rods in alcohol.
  • DNA is minimally solvated in alcohol.
  • Phosphate groups on DNA stick out into the
    solvent allow DNA to be solvated.
  • Greater solvent Dielectric constant, greater the
    degree of DNA solvation

Replication, Transcription Translation
  • Central Dogma in Biology
  • DNA
  • RNA
  • Protein
  • Copying DNA strands is called replication.
  • Synthesis of RNA based on one DNA strand (called
    template) is transcription.
  • Synthesis of proteins from RNA is called
    translation.
